- Alhaji Lamin Muktar Hassan, Deputy Managing Director of Kano State’s REMASAB, returned over N4.7 million mistakenly credited to his account, showcasing integrity and professionalism
- Despite financial challenges, Hassan quickly realized the payment error and reported it to the Ministry of Finance and Accountant Generals Office, ensuring the funds were returned
- Hassans actions, guided by a sense of responsibility as a Kano indigene, have earned praise, highlighting the importance of ethical conduct and accountability in public service
Patriotic Kano Govt Worker Returns N4.7m Mistakenly Credited To His Bank AccountSource: TwitterThis payment matched the arrears I had been owed for December 2024, but it didnt include my actual January salary. It was clearly a mistake, and I knew I had to take immediate action,” Hassan explained.”I immediately contacted the relevant authorities to report the overpayment. I didnt want to take what didnt belong to me. I returned the full amount and even obtained a receipt to confirm the return,” Hassan said.”As a proud Kano indigene, I believe its my responsibility to ensure that public funds are used properly. “Even though I had less than 10% of that amount in my account and hadnt received my actual salary yet, I knew returning the money was the right thing to do,” he said.
